Gilda J. (Birarelli) Ebert of Medford, passed away on Monday, March 7, 2011 at Winchester Hospital. She was 95 years of age.



Born in Everett, Gilda was the daughter of the late Georgina (Sbrasia) Birarelli and Augusto Birarelli.



Gilda was better known to her family as Mommy, Aunt Gilda, Nanna Gilda, Big Nanna, Old Na. She loved her family more than anything and cooked for every party they had, her cooking was second to none. Gilda's grandsons only would eat her famous meatballs and cutlets, the Eggplant was no comparison to anyone else, whenever served it was gone as quick as she put it down. Gilda loved sitting on her wicker chair on the front porch in the warm weather. She was always ready to go anywhere you wanted to go. She never worked outside of the home but took care of her children with a mothers love that was beyond compare. Gilda loved life and will be missed like no other.



Gilda was the beloved wife of the late Arthur Ebert. She was the devoted mother of Leonard Ebert and his wife Dorothea of Reading, Donna Ebert of Medford, Gilda "Jill" LaVita and her husband Robert of Wilmington and Richard Travers of Medford. She was the cherished grandmother of James Ebert of Reading, Dennis Ebert and his wife Jennifer of Everett, Rob LaVita and his wife Melissa of Wakefield, Michael LaVita and his wife Lynn of Wilmington and the late Michele Ebert. Great grandmother of 11. Gilda was the dear sister of Father Carlo Birarelli and the late Elvira Puopolo and Leo Birarelli. She is also survived by her dog Snowball and many loving nieces and nephews.
